The Atlanta Hawks have made their move, they have parted ways with Lloyd Pierce per Woj of ESPN. This is not a surprising move by any stretch of the imagination. Pierce ended his time with the Hawks with a 63-120 win/loss record which was good for only 34.4 percent.
While Pierce has been better this season, the Hawks still have a losing record with 14-20, which is only good for 41.2 percent. Given the Hawks spent millions for Danilo Gallinari, Bogdan Bogdanovic, Kris Dunn, and Rajon Rondo, this is not a good enough improvement.
